Ingind, -gynd, -gynit, a. [f. Ingine n. 1.] Having intelligence or ability, gifted. —a1585 Polwart Flyt. 149 (T).
Jak stro, be better anes ingynit [v. rr. Ingynd, -ginde] Or I will flyt aganis my sell
